# Gal Gadot Backs AI ‘Bitcoin’ and Nears a Wonder Woman Exit

*Gadot says actors must work with AI or leave the game, though she spent six months shielding her own performance from it. She also says another Wonder Woman film no longer fits her life.*

By Dorothy Kwan, 2026-09-07 · The Argument

Gal Gadot defended starring in Doug Liman’s AI-assisted thriller *Bitcoin* in an interview reported August 31 and September 1, while casting serious doubt on ever playing Wonder Woman again. The $70 million production used AI for sets and lighting; Gadot says her lawyers spent six months making sure the technology could not alter her acting. She also told Ynet that disappearing into another Wonder Woman shoot no longer works with four children in different schools. For film readers, the two declarations belong together: Gadot will accept a production system built to remove physical work from the frame, but she has nearly closed the door on the role that made her a franchise star.

## Gal Gadot protects her performance, but AI gets the room

Gadot’s defence of *Bitcoin* contains a boundary sharp enough to cut paper. AI can make the sets. AI can handle the lighting. AI cannot touch Gal Gadot.

“This was the longest contract I have ever worked on,” she said on Josh Horowitz’s *Happy Sad Confused* podcast, according to TheWrap. Her lawyers spent six months considering ways the technology might interfere with her performance. Gadot said SAG later contacted them for advice on protections for other actors.

That legal marathon gives the game away. The sales pitch says inevitability; the contract says danger. Gadot told Horowitz that she fears AI but refuses to look away from it. “The train has left the station,” she said. Work with the technology, in her formulation, or wind up “out of the game completely.”

You can admire the candour and still notice who bought a ticket and who may end up beneath the wheels. The A.V. Club characterized the production’s AI use as replacing work normally done by set and lighting crews. Gadot insisted that *Bitcoin* employed a large crew. The reporting does not give a department-by-department count, so it does not settle how many jobs the system kept, changed or removed.

## Doug Liman’s $70 million gray box promises 200 locations

The cast — Gadot, Casey Affleck, Pete Davidson and Isla Fisher — worked inside a former car showroom lined with gray screen, according to Yahoo. The production called it the “gray box.” Actors never travelled to the story’s roughly 200 locations; backgrounds and lighting came later.

Producer Ryan Kavanaugh claims a conventional shoot would have cost more than $300 million, Yahoo reported, putting the claimed saving above $200 million. TheWrap reported that the production shot for 20 days on a custom soundstage and cost $70 million. Those savings come from the filmmakers, not an independent audit.

Gadot liked the speed. Without conventional lighting changes, she said, the actors could continue for ten hours and stay emotionally warm. She compared the near-empty space to theatre and called the process pure. Then came the useful pinprick: she had not seen a single shot.

So nobody should describe the finished result yet, including Gadot. The movie may look miraculous, synthetic or like a cryptocurrency advert trapped inside a screensaver. At present, it is a costly promise rendered in gray.

## *Bitcoin* reopens the Craig Wright argument Hollywood cannot settle

The technology is only half the combustible package. Cointribune reports that the film follows Gadot as a journalist investigating Craig Wright, with Affleck playing Wright and Davidson playing his longtime supporter Calvin Ayre. The outlet says the story favors Wright’s claim that he created Bitcoin under the name Satoshi Nakamoto, and that Ayre helped finance the film.

A British court rejected Wright’s claim in 2024 and found that documents supporting his case had been forged, as Cointribune reported. A feature film cannot reverse that judgment. It can, however, package a rejected account with stars, chases and handsome digital weather until an old falsehood acquires the posture of entertainment.

Cointribune also reported that the film had no confirmed US distributor as of September 4. That leaves its reach unknown. The filmmakers have built a globe-trotting thriller without globetrotting; they have not yet secured the final trip into American cinemas.

## Wonder Woman no longer fits Gadot’s life

Gadot told Ynet that another Wonder Woman production may demand more time away than she will now give. With four children attending different schools, she said, checking out of family life for an extended shoot “doesn’t work for my life anymore.” This is not a formal retirement announcement. It is a practical refusal with very little cape left fluttering in it.

She also criticized DC’s treatment of director Patty Jenkins and former Superman actor Henry Cavill during the studio transition, calling neither case elegant, according to Ynet. TheWrap reported that Gadot said DC Studios chiefs James Gunn and Peter Safran had asked her to return for a third film, but she had watched how others were handled.

There is the reversal worth keeping. Wonder Woman, a physical production whose boots Gadot wore across several films, now asks too much of her life. *Bitcoin*, shot in a gray room with the world added afterward, offers ten uninterrupted hours of acting and a contract that walls off her face, voice and gestures. The future, apparently, arrives as an empty car showroom — and six months of lawyers deciding which parts of you may enter it.
